I got inspired by a Martha Stewart ad I found in a magazine. I was really attracted to the colors and the serenity I felt when I looked at it. I wanted to try and replicate the look with my card. I layered the dandelion stamps from Green Thumb to create a pretty two-toned flower. The large dandelion in mellow moss and the smaller one layered on top with true thyme. As an afterthought, I wish I hadn't done the paper piecing up the sides of the stems, but I wasn't about to re-create the card all over again!
